IIRC (the academy was over 13 years ago for me) they have Halon systems where regular water or ansul (the stuff that is in normal abc extinguishers) would ruin the equipment. Examples would be high end computer equipment rooms or in the engine bays of racecars. The BIG problem with these is that while it displaces the O2 to extinquish the fire there isn't any O2 for people to breathe and they would croak unless they had SCBA equipment available and if they could put it on in time (kind of like when you are in an airplane and they tell you to put your mask on before your child's). A lot of commercial boats have remote operated fire fighting systems in their engine rooms. In the event of an engine fire, the crew or captain would pull a cable (a manual engagement since an engine room fire usually cripples the vessel's electrical system) and it releases a chemical that "sucks out" or "absorbs" the oxygen in the engine room. They tell you never to go into the engine room to fight the fire....and to never be down there when the system is in operation as it removes all of the oxygen. FWIW most engine rooms have watertight doors, hatches and bulkheads.
we were told never to use them unless the fire was out of control and to attempt to fight it with the extinguishers located OUTSIDE of the engine room or in a pinch, with the fire hoses or deck hose.
